I'm looking for a fun nighttime activity for DH, DS(12) & me. We usually spend our evenings in Epcot, or have a late dinner, then back to FW to watch Wishes and EWP. I'm looking for something not in the parks. Also, our whole family hates to shop. We're having dinner at RFC @ AK, then I'm looking for something a little different and alot of fun for us all, but especially DS (12 going on 25 :earboy2: ) Be creative & give me your best shot. :wave2:
 
Have you tried DisneyQuest at DTD? I have never been, but it sounds like a really neat place, probably especially so for a 12 yo boy.
 
Yeah, we've been to DQ, and he loves it. He and DH have already planned to spend an entire day there. Thanks for the suggestion though. :) Any more?
 
The Boardwalk. There are a number of places to hang - some adult (like Jellyrolls) but ESPN, while a bar/restaurant, is the type of place you can bring a 12 year old into (just not too late when the drunks become more numerous). The Boardwalk has street entertainment and games as well.

I personally hate the idea of kids at Pleasure Island, but it is allowed. The Comedy Club and Adventurers Club will be open to him in your company.

For a really grown up time, several of the lounges (the Bellevue Room at the Boardwalk for instance) would be a great place for a soda (or drink for the gorwn ups) and a game of cards.
 

How about the campfire and movie at FW?

or instead of a monorail drink-a-thon, you do arcades, snacks or pressed penny machines with the ride. Take the time to wait for the front of the monorail on one leg of the trip.
